WebApr 1, 2000 · Nucleated RBCs (NRBCs) are immature RBCs not normally seen in the peripheral blood beyond the neonatal period. Their appearance in peripheral blood of children and adults signifies bone marrow damage or stress and potentially serious underlying disease. Their presence in peripheral blood of … iron fist cast joyWebMar 4, 2015 · The nucleus-to-cytoplasm (N : C) ratio is a morphologic feature used to identify and stage red blood cell and white blood cell precursors. The ratio is a visual estimate of what area of the cell is occupied by the nucleus compared with the cytoplasm.
